Code Duplication    Length = 15-20 lines in 2 locations

app/Console/Commands/MakeJsonApiDemo.php 1 location

@@ 104-118 (lines=15) @@
101
        $this->info('JsonApi demo entities generated successfully.');
102
    }
103
104
    protected function setupTest()
105
    {
106
        foreach ($this->migrations as $key => $value) {
107
            $this->migrations[$key] = $value . $this->testPostfix;
108
        }
109
        foreach ($this->seeds as $key => $value) {
110
            $this->seeds[$key] = $value . $this->testPostfix;
111
        }
112
        foreach ($this->controllers as $key => $value) {
113
            $this->controllers[$key] = $value . $this->testPostfix;
114
        }
115
        foreach ($this->models as $key => $value) {
116
            $this->models[$key] = $value . $this->testPostfix;
117
        }
118
    }
119
120
    /**
121
     *  use fake file system for tests

app/Console/Commands/MakeJsonApiDemoRemove.php 1 location

@@ 149-168 (lines=20) @@
146
        $this->info('JsonApi demo entities removed successfully.');
147
    }
148
149
    protected function setupTest()
150
    {
151
        foreach ($this->migrations as $key => $value) {
152
            $this->migrations[$key] = $value . $this->testPostfix;
153
        }
154
        foreach ($this->seeds as $key => $value) {
155
            $this->seeds[$key] = $value . $this->testPostfix;
156
        }
157
        foreach ($this->controllers as $key => $value) {
158
            $this->controllers[$key] = $value . $this->testPostfix;
159
        }
160
        foreach ($this->models as $key => $value) {
161
            $this->models[$key] = $value . $this->testPostfix;
162
        }
163
        $this->jsonapiEntities = $this->jsonapiEntitiesTest;
164
165
//        foreach ($this->jsonapiEntities as $key => $value) {
166
//            $this->jsonapiEntities[$key] = $value . $this->testPostfix;
167
//        }
168
    }
169
170
    protected function removeModels()
171
    {